Zimbabwe’s Robert Mugabe has asked people to give the US President Donald Trump time.

Mugabe in excerpts of an interview by state media that will be broadcasted to mark his 93rd birthday on Tuesday said Trump’s Mexico wall “appears quite nasty” but the US president “might come up with better policies”.

“I don’t know whether the construction of the wall between America and Mexico is feasible… it appears quite nasty,” the Sunday Mail quoted Mugabe.

Mugabe was largely unwilling to criticize Trump, though he did admit the US president was “radical”.

“I was surprised by his election but I didn’t like Madam Clinton either,” he said.

Mugabe also said it was “arrogant” of former US president Barack Obama to extend sanctions on Zimbabwe before he left office in January.

The Zimbabwean President who has been in power since his country’s independence in 1980 said he was ready to work with Trump’s Republican administration adding that he has no problem with Trump’s idea of American nationalism.
